/* Info
		SSG-FI Cascading Style Sheet
		validated as CSS by
		http://jigsaw.w3.org/css-validator/validator-uri.html
		Version 0.4, Alexander Huber (SSG-FI)
		TeXDocC Cascading Style Sheet
		Version 0.7, Thomas Fischer
*/


BODY		{background-color: #FFFFFF ;
		margin-left: 5pt;
		font-size: 12pt;
		font-family: Arial, Helvetica, Sans-Serif }

/* Haupthindergrund */
BODY.main {background-color: #F0F8FF ;
		margin-left: 5pt;
		font-size: 12pt;
		font-family: Arial, Helvetica, Sans-Serif }


DIV		{font-size: 10pt;
		font-family: Arial, Helvetica, Sans-Serif }

DIV.main {text-align: center;
		height: 95%;
		background-color: #D3D3D3;
		margin-top: 0}

.fuss		{color: black;
		font-weight: normal;
		font-size: 8pt;
		font-family: arial, helvetica, sans-serif;
		text-align: center}


/* Überschriften */

H1		{color: #006699;
		font-size: 14pt;
		font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}

H2		{font-size: 13pt;
		font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}

H2RED		{color: #990000;
		font-size: 13pt;
		font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}

H3		{font-size: 12pt;
		font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}

H4		{font-size: 11pt;
		font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}


/* Dokumentauszeichungen */

.colag		{background-color:#fcecd2;
		 margin-left: 0em }

#red		{color:red; }
#white		{color:white; }
#gray		{color:#bbbbbb; }
#bold		{font-weight:bold; }

.blau		{color: #006699}
.rot		{color: #CC3300}

.justme		{font-size:10pt;
		line-height:11pt;
		text-align:justify; ;
		font-family: Arial, Helvetica, Sans-Serif }

.small		{font-size:8pt;
		font-family: Arial, Helvetica, Sans-Serif }

.normal		{font-size:10pt;
		font-family: Arial, Helvetica, Sans-Serif }

.large		{font-size:11pt;
		font-family: Arial, Helvetica, Sans-Serif }

.Large		{font-size:12pt;
		font-family: Arial, Helvetica, Sans-Serif }

.LARGE		{font-size:14pt;
		font-family: Arial, Helvetica, Sans-Serif }

.fuss		{font-size: 8pt;
		text-align: center;
		font-family: Arial, Helvetica, Sans-Serif }

.unter		{font-size: 11pt;
		font-family: Arial, Helvetica, Sans-Serif }


ADDRESS		{font-style: italic ;
		font-weight: normal;
		font-size: 10pt;
		font-family: Arial, Helvetica, Sans-Serif }

XP		{color: black;
		font-weight: normal;
		font-size: 10pt;
		font-family: Arial, Helvetica, Sans-Serif }

P		{color: black;
		font-weight: normal;
		margin-left: 5pt;
		font-size: 10pt;
		font-family: Arial, Helvetica, Sans-Serif }


/* Listen */

INPUT		{font-size: 10pt;
		font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}

SELECT		{font-size: 10pt;
		font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}

OPTION		{font-size: 10pt;
		font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}

DL		{font-size: 10pt;
		margin-left: 5pt;
		font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}

UL		{font-size: 10pt;
		font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}

LI		{font-size: 10pt;
		font-family: Arial, Helvetica, Sans-Serif }

uebersicht		{font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}


/* Navigation */

.zurueck		{font-weight: normal;
		font-size: 8pt;
		text-align: center ;
		font-family: Arial, Helvetica, Sans-Serif }


/* Absätze */

.text		{font-weight: normal;
		font-family: Arial, Helvetica, Sans-Serif }


/* Zeichen */

.center		{text-align: center;
		font-family: Arial, Helvetica, Sans-Serif }

.gesperrt		{letter-spacing: 0.2em ;
		font-family: Arial, Helvetica, Sans-Serif }

.kapital		{text-transform: capitalize ;
		font-family: Arial, Helvetica, Sans-Serif }

TT		{font-weight: normal;
		font-family: "courier new", courier, monospace }

I		{font-weight: normal;
		font-style: italic;
		font-family: Arial, Helvetica, Sans-Serif }

EM		{font-weight: normal;
		font-size: 10pt;
		font-style: italic ;
		font-family: Arial, Helvetica, Sans-Serif }

B		{font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}

STRONG		{color: black;
		font-weight: bold;
		font-family: Arial, Helvetica, Sans-Serif }


/* Tabellen */

TABLE		{padding-left: 0pt;
		font-size: 10pt;
		font-family: arial, helvetica, sans-serif }

TABLE.main		{border: 0;
		width: 100%;
		height: 75%;
		background-color: #D3D3D3}

TR		{background-color: #FFFFFF}

TH		{text-align: left;
		vertical-align: top;
		font-size: 10pt;
		background-color: #FFFFFF;
		font-family: Arial, Helvetica, Sans-Serif }

TH.HEAD		{padding-top: 0pt;
		font-size: 10pt;
		background-color: #DDDDDD }

.HEAD	{padding-top: 0pt;
		font-size: 10pt;
		background-color: #DDDDDD }

TD	{color: black;
		font-weight: normal;
		font-size: 10pt;
		background-color: #FFFFFF;
		font-family: Arial, Helvetica, Sans-Serif }

TD.main{
		background-color: #8D85B6}
/*
		$main_background = #8D85B6
		float: top;
 */

TD.choice {
		height: 30px;
		background-color: #8D85B6;
		text-align: center
		}

TD.cancel_background {
		height: 30px;
		background-color: #667AB6;
		text-align: center
		}

TD.menu_background {
		height: 30px;
		background-color: #8D85B6;
		text-align: center
		}

TD.search_background {
		height: 30px;
		background-color: #8D85B6;
		text-align: center
		}

TD.logout_background {
		height: 30px;
		background-color: #667AB6;
		text-align: center
		}

TD.out {
		height: 30px;
		background-color: #667AB6;
		text-align: center
		}

TH.center		{text-align: center}

.t1	{font-weight: bold}

.t2	{color: black;
		font-weight: normal;
		font-size: 10pt;
		font-family: arial, helvetica, sans-serif }

.t3	{color: black;
		font-weight: normal;
		font-size: 10pt;
		font-family: arial, helvetica, sans-serif }

/*Bilder*/
IMG.right{
		margin-right: 5px;
		margin-top: 10px;
		float: right}


/* Für TeX */
TEX		{letter-spacing: -0.1em }
SPAN.tex		{letter-spacing: -0.1em }
LOW {vertical-align: -20%}
SPAN.low {vertical-align: -20%}

A:link		{color:#29166F; text-decoration:none; }
A:visited		{color:#29166F; text-decoration:none; }
A:active		{color: #29166F; text-decoration:none; }
A:hover		{color:#CC0033;}
A.external:hover		{color: #3300FF;}


/*
<xsl:variable name="background" select="'#F0F8FF'"/>
<xsl:variable name="link" select="'#29166F'"/>
<xsl:variable name="alink" select="'#29166F'"/>
<xsl:variable name="vlink" select="'#29166F'"/>
<xsl:variable name="table_background" select="'#D3D3D3'"/>
<xsl:variable name="logo_background" select="'#D3D3D3'"/>
<xsl:variable name="title_background" select="'#D3D3D3'"/>
<xsl:variable name="title_color" select="'color: #667AB6'"/>
<xsl:variable name="main_background" select="'#8D85B6'"/>
<xsl:variable name="menu_background" select="'#8D85B6'"/>
<xsl:variable name="search_background" select="'#8D85B6'"/>
<xsl:variable name="cancel_background" select="'#667AB6'"/>
<xsl:variable name="logout_background" select="'#667AB6'"/>
*/